Village Overview

Kundhi is a village in Bhogaon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Mainpuri district, Uttar Pradesh. For Kundhi, the population is 1,459, PIN code is 206303 and Census village code is 126868. Location and Administration

Kundhi comes under Kundhi 0212 gram panchayat and Bewar C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Bhogaon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The tehsil headquarters is Bhogaon at 20 km. The Census district headquarters, Mainpuri, is 34 km away.

Agriculture and Land Use

Land-use area is reported in hectares using Census village directory land-use categories such as net area sown, irrigated area, forest, fallow land and non-agricultural use. This is useful for general village research, farming context and local area study.

Agriculture and land-use records for Kundhi
Net area sown128.35 hectares
Irrigated area121.15 hectares
Unirrigated area8.20 hectares
Wells / tube wells irrigated area120.15 hectares
Non-agricultural area6.38 hectares
Current fallow land3.10 hectares
Main cropWheat
Second cropMaize
Third cropPotato
